Service Monitor currently requires an administrator to log in and manually identify and remove aged data records, with no mechanism to detect or purge data once it exceeds a defined age automatically. This enhancement would allow Service Monitor to automatically detect data that has aged past a configurable threshold and delete it without requiring manual review or action. Customers would benefit from reduced administrative overhead and more consistent data hygiene, particularly in environments where aged data accumulates frequently and manual cleanup is not sustainable.
